Q1: What types of cases do you handle in Portland?A1: We handle wrongful death cases in Portland arising from situations like car accidents, medical malpractice, workplace accidents, and negligent security, among others.
Q2: Am I eligible to file a wrongful death claim in Portland?
A2: Eligibility depends on who survived the deceased and the specific laws in Oregon. We can review your situation to determine if you qualify.
Q3: How long do I have to file a wrongful death claim in Portland?A3: Oregon has a statute of limitations, typically two years from the date of death for filing a wrongful death claim. We advise contacting us promptly.
